            <description><![CDATA[Yay! It's that time of the year again for the Farmers' Market
to open again.

The Farmer's Market is on located Fountain Avenue between the Clark County Heritage Center and Elderly United. The market will be open from 9:00am-1:00pm Saturdays until 9-27-08
Info call: 937-536-9408]]></description>

            <description><![CDATA[We hope all of you got through the storm okay. We have put direct links to the Clark County Emergency Management Agency.

We spoke with the acting director Lisa D'Allessandris yesterday and she stated that all of us should contact their office with an estimate of our damages so that they can contact the Federal Government to qualify for assistance.

            <description><![CDATA[I just had the coolest thing happen. I went on this website and found $250.00 that I did not know belonged to me.

The website is Missing Money.com and it is free. You just plug your name in and the state you live in and you will come up with the results. The key is to search for the previous addresses at which you lived by scrolling down through the list.

The really neat thing is that this money I found goes back at least twenty years ago. You might think that it would expire or something, but it did not.
